Output 68720ee60606d2451dfd7764bdc58d5e2946efa44caf73acdb4e0fb59d4e3970:0

value
75176476
script pubkey
OP_0 OP_PUSHBYTES_20 8653403549fc485f2b0c02037ee4d30571aa127d
address
ltc1qsef5qd2fl3y972cvqgphaexnq4c65ynawdn488
transaction
68720ee60606d2451dfd7764bdc58d5e2946efa44caf73acdb4e0fb59d4e3970
spent
true